1.
Using spanner wrench, remove cylinder head (2) from elevating cylinder body (3).
2.
Remove piston rod (1) from elevating cylinder body (3).
3.
Remove lockwire (17), nut (18), washer (16), retainer (15), seal (14), piston (13), rod seal (5), cylinder
head (2), and wiper strip (8) from piston rod (1). Discard lockwire (17), piston seal (14), rod seal (5),
and wiper strip (8).
